IGN: Sword Of The New World Q&A

Almost a year has passed since K2 Networks launched its MMORPG Sword of the New World: Granado Espada into a marketplace full of high-profile games such as World of Warcraft. The game had a mixed reception at launch, though the producers and developers have continued to polish and improve the game. There have been some drastic changes, so to get an idea of where the game is now and where it's headed, IGN caught up with associate producer Jon-Enée Merriex.
